Re: Doing a number 2 in her bed! Help!
Try getting up every hour in the night to take her out, you may only need to do this on one night, note down the time that she WILL have a poo, then get up at that time to take her out. once you have caught the time, you can start extending it, getting to her 5 mins later each night. Teaching her to hold herself.
Or you could try her without the crate? Put newspaper down well away from her bed at night. This may help her differentiate from the two. If all you do doesn't seem to work then I will advise seeing a behaviourist. Hope I have helped?? ![]() |

Re: Doing a number 2 in her bed! Help!
Quote:
If the dog has been an outside dog, they have not learnt to hold themselves like a normal fully grown adult, they are used to going where and when they want, and being adult it is more ingrained and harder to train them out of it, so no matter what she does it will be "double the work" The main thing is that she needs to teach the dog that toilet and bed are not the same. Then she can work on proper house training procedures. I had exactly the same problem with Tilly, and she was 10 months when I got her, so younger. |

Re: Doing a number 2 in her bed! Help!
Quote:
Washing it with bio washing powder helps to eliminate the previous smell, she obviously associates the bedding with toileting so maybe if that doesnt work replace it with something else.... U would really have to take her out as often as possible in the hope she will do a poo and reward, reward, reward ..... im sure u get it sorted ![]() |
